Chimney installation services involve constructing and setting up a functional chimney system that safely directs smoke, gases, and combustion byproducts out of a building. These services typically include designing the chimney layout, selecting appropriate materials, and ensuring proper assembly to meet the specific needs of a property. Whether building a new fireplace, stove, or heating appliance, experienced contractors focus on creating a reliable venting solution that enhances safety and efficiency for homeowners.

One common reason homeowners seek chimney installation is to address issues related to outdated or damaged chimneys that no longer provide proper venting. Poorly functioning chimneys can lead to smoke backdrafts, increased indoor air pollution, or even fire hazards. Installing a new chimney can help resolve these problems by improving airflow, preventing leaks, and ensuring that combustion gases are safely expelled. Proper installation also minimizes the risk of structural damage caused by moisture or heat exposure over time.

The overview below groups typical Chimney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- typical costs for routine chimney repairs or cleaning range from $250 to $600. Many projects in this category are straightforward and fall within this middle range, though prices can vary based on the extent of work needed.

Partial Chimney Rebuilds - more extensive repairs, such as rebuilding sections of the chimney, generally cost between $1,000 and $3,000. Larger projects tend to push into higher tiers, but most are completed within this range.

Full Chimney Replacement - replacing an entire chimney can range from $3,500 to $7,000 or more, depending on the size and complexity. Many full replacements fall within this higher bracket, especially for larger or more detailed installations.

Custom or Complex Installations - custom chimney designs or complex installations, including decorative features or specialty materials, can reach $8,000+ in costs. These projects are less common and often involve additional customization or engineering considerations.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of chimneys can local contractors install? Local service providers can install various types of chimneys, including masonry, prefabricated, and zero-clearance models, based on the home's structure and needs.

How do I know if my home needs a new chimney installation? A professional assessment by local contractors can determine if a chimney upgrade or new installation is necessary for safety, efficiency, or aesthetic reasons.

What materials are commonly used in chimney installations? Common materials include brick, metal, and concrete, which local pros select based on the chimney type and local building codes.

Are there different styles of chimneys available? Yes, local service providers can install various styles, such as traditional, contemporary, or decorative chimneys, to match the home's design.
